What happens when life suddenly changes? When your plans are trashed, and everything you planned for suddenly and drastically changes?

Derek Demun was living the dream, A world class snowboarder, he was chasing winter across the globe. When at the age of 21 a construction accident changed it all. breaking his back at the T-8 Derek was suddenly a parapalegic from the chest down. How did he cope? What were his challenges? Where did he turn for help?

Today, T-8 Outdoorsman is chasing his dream of hunting, fishing and more. In his wheelchair he continues to live his dreams, hunting elk, deer, alligators and more. Derek is an inspiration and he shares how his faith in Christ has sustained him through all of this. Now age 34, Derek is still in his wheelchair, and still rolling through life with a positive attitude and making the most out of his situation.

Pete Rogers resides in Saluda County, SC and is a graduate from the University of South Carolina and earned a master’s in divinity degree from Erskine Theological Seminary before being ordained. More than twenty-five years ago, Pete began merging his love for writing with his love of the outdoors.

Pete spends many days a year afield enjoying God’s creation while hunting, fishing, hiking, or camping. He has traveled to 49 states, as well as numerous Canadian provinces, pursuing his passion in the outdoors. Through these and other experiences, Pete has published more than 1,400 magazine articles and 4,000 photographs in his career. His stories and photographs have earned more than 60 awards in literary, photographic, and videography competitions. He is also the author of six books.

Christian Outdoors Podcast has been awarded “Best Podcast” four years in a row by the South Carolina Outdoor Press Association. His weekly episodes are exciting and uplifting and bring a passion for the outdoors and his Lord and Savior.

Currently, Christian Outdoors has more than 14 million downloads and is growing. More about Pete can be found at christianoutdoors.org/
Jon Goodwin is a devoted husband of more than 25 years to his wife, Jennifer, and a proud father of three grown children. He serves as pastor of Hartland Bible Church, where he has the privilege of shepherding his church family and sharing the hope of the Gospel.

A lifelong lover of God’s creation, Jon is an avid whitetail deer hunter and outdoorsman. His passion for the outdoors has also led to years of involvement in the outdoor industry, including serving on the CVA Pro Staff team. For Jon, hunting is about much more than the pursuit—it’s an opportunity to slow down, enjoy God’s creation, build relationships, and recognize the connection between faith and the outdoors.

Whether preaching from the pulpit, recording weekly devotions with Christian Outdoors, sharing his testimony at a sportsman’s banquet, or simply gathering around a campfire with fellow outdoorsmen, Jon enjoys connecting with people and pointing them toward Jesus. For Jon, faith, family, community, and the outdoors are opportunities to serve, build relationships, and give God glory.
